Star Entertainment in new scandal over gaming chips

Star has acknowledged that it sold gaming chips at its Treasury Casino illegally, dealing a blow to the Australian gaming industry. It achieved this by permitting bettors to make purchases using credit cards.

Star permitted customers to pay with credit cards for chips when they visited its casinos in Queensland. The company's admission that it had falsified records to let Chinese gamblers use their UnionPay cards was the direct cause of these revelations. Chinese law states that those bank cards cannot be used to make gambling-related purchases.
